Jira Review: Pros, Cons, Features & Pricing

Jira is a product management tool that helps teams plan, track, and manage Agile software development projects. It's ideal for software development teams, IT departments, and tech companies like startups and enterprises seeking efficient project coordination. Jira's value lies in its ability to enhance team collaboration and streamline project workflows, making your work more organized and productive.
